Intense aromas of eldeflower and grapefruit, soft herbaceous undertones of freshly cut grass providing a mineral edge. On the palate its bright and vibrant with citrus and tropical flavours, balanced by beautiful fresh, crisp acidity.
Located in the heart of ‘the garden of England’, in Kent, Chapel Down is England’s leading wine producer striving to change the way the world thinks about English wine.
Chapel Down produce wines using grapes from vineyards across Kent, Sussex and Essex, which benefit from a warm, maritime climate – crafting wines with balance and unique flavour profiles.
Chapel Down set out to experiment, releasing their ‘discoveries series’ in 2021, which uses modernised winemaking practices to get a bettr understanding of the versatility of this fairly new wine region.
